Awakening of the Abyss: A Bokura Boys' Afterlife Tale
In the shadowed corners of the Necromancer's Nexus, a place where the fabric of reality is frayed and the veils between worlds are thin, there lived a young man named Kaito. Kaito was no ordinary soul; he was the last descendant of the ancient Bokura family, a lineage that had been forgotten by time. His father, a legendary necromancer, had vanished without a trace, leaving behind only cryptic messages about the Afterlife Awakening and the Abyss's Awe.
The Bokura Boys were a trio of brothers who had once walked the earth, wielding the power to traverse the realms of the living and the dead. They were said to have been the guardians of the balance between the worlds, but with their disappearance, chaos threatened to consume all existence.
Kaito's life had been a series of disjointed memories and cryptic dreams. Each night, he would find himself at the edge of a vast, dark abyss, hearing whispers of his ancestors' names and the promise of a power that he could not yet understand. It was not until the day a mysterious book, titled "The Bokura Boys' Afterlife Awakening," fell into his hands that Kaito's life took a turn for the bizarre.
The book spoke of an ancient ritual that could awaken the Bokura Boys and restore balance to the realms. It was a ritual that required the blood of a pure descendant, a descendant who had not yet touched the darkness of the Abyss. Kaito knew that he was that descendant, but the path was fraught with peril.
As he delved deeper into the Nexus, Kaito encountered creatures of shadow and light, each with its own tale and a piece of the puzzle. He met a young woman named Hana, whose eyes held the secrets of the afterlife and whose heart was bound to his own. Together, they embarked on a journey that would lead them through the hells of the living and the dead.
The first step was to find the three pieces of the Bokura Boys' staff, scattered across the Nexus. Each piece was guarded by a creature of immense power and cunning. The staff itself was said to be the key to awakening the Bokura Boys and preventing the Abyss from consuming the world.
The first piece was in the hands of a vampire, who had been cursed to live in eternal twilight. Kaito and Hana faced the vampire in a battle of wills and wits, ultimately winning the staff piece through Kaito's newfound ability to communicate with the dead.
The second piece was in the domain of a powerful sorcerer who had sealed his own soul within a crystal. Kaito's father's teachings proved invaluable as he used the sorcerer's own spells against him, freeing the staff piece and revealing a hidden passage that led deeper into the Nexus.
The third piece was guarded by a beast of immense strength and intelligence, a dragon of ancient lineage. Kaito and Hana had to prove their worth to the dragon, who tested them with riddles and trials of courage. Their bond and Kaito's growing connection to the dead helped them to pass the dragon's test.
With the three pieces in hand, Kaito and Hana returned to the Nexus' heart, where the ritual was to take place. The air was thick with tension as they prepared to awaken the Bokura Boys. But just as they began the incantation, a shadowy figure appeared, the specter of Kaito's father's greatest nemesis.
The nemesis, a being of immense power and malice, had been searching for the ritual for centuries, knowing that it could grant him dominion over both worlds. He attacked, and the Nexus trembled with the force of their clash.
In the heat of battle, Kaito discovered the true extent of his connection to the Bokura Boys. He could channel the power of the dead, and with Hana's aid, they managed to push back the nemesis. But the victory was bittersweet, as the ritual had taken a heavy toll on Kaito's body and spirit.
The Bokura Boys emerged from the abyss, their ancient forms shrouded in darkness. They were greeted by Kaito and Hana, who had become the bridge between the living and the dead. The boys, now free from the abyss, were aghast at the state of their world. They saw the chaos that the nemesis had wrought and knew that they had to act quickly.
With the Bokura Boys by his side, Kaito faced the nemesis one last time. The battle was fierce, with Kaito's newfound powers clashing against the nemesis's dark sorcery. The world watched in horror as the Nexus seemed to crack, threatening to tear apart reality itself.
But as the nemesis's power waned, Kaito, driven by the memory of his father and the love of Hana, found the strength to push forward. The Bokura Boys, now fully awakened, joined the fray, and together, they banished the nemesis to the depths from which it had come.
The Nexus was saved, and the balance between worlds was restored. Kaito and Hana, now united by more than just fate, stood at the edge of the abyss, watching as the world began to heal. The Bokura Boys, with their new guardian, vowed to protect the Nexus and the living world from any threat that might arise.
And so, Kaito's journey had come to an end, but his legacy had just begun. The Bokura Boys' Afterlife Awakening had indeed occurred, and the Abyss's Awe had been quelled, but the path to the afterlife remained a mystery, one that would be explored by those who dared to walk the path of the dead.
In the end, Kaito looked into the abyss and saw not fear, but a promise of life beyond the veil. He knew that the Bokura Boys would watch over him, guiding him in his new role as the guardian of the Nexus, and that together, they would ensure that the balance between worlds would never be threatened again.
